Alert fatigue has become one of the biggest challenges for modern observability teams. As environments grow in complexity and alert volumes climb, teams are forced into a constant cycle of prioritization that makes it difficult to ensure critical issues don’t slip through the cracks. Tools like PagerDuty play an essential role in incident management and response, but they don’t provide insight into which alerts actually need attention. This lack of clarity exacerbates alert fatigue and contributes to engineer burnout over time. 

Edge Delta’s AI Teammates are purpose-built to address alert fatigue and keep you focused on the issues that matter. These role-aware, out-of-the-box AI agents autonomously analyze alerts, surface legitimate signals from noise, correlate relevant telemetry data, and identify root causes. This enables on-call engineers to make informed decisions faster without getting bogged down in manual triage.

Easily Connect Your PagerDuty Environment with AI Teammates

Edge Delta’s PagerDuty Connector enables AI Teammates to ingest PagerDuty tickets in just a few minutes. Once connected, every critical PagerDuty alert automatically triggers AI Teammates to analyze relevant telemetry data, correlate events across services, and build a diagnostic timeline to guide you during your on-call shift.

To set this up, you’ll first need to navigate to the Connectors page in your Edge Delta account and click “Add Connector.” From there, select the PagerDuty connector, click the “Connect” button, and follow the OAuth flow to link your PagerDuty instance. Save the newly created webhook URL and token — you’ll need these to configure the webhook in PagerDuty: 

In your PagerDuty account, navigate to Integrations → Webhooks from the main nav and create a new webhook instance. Paste the webhook URL from Edge Delta, and add the authentication token as a custom header with the following parameters:

Name: Authorization
Value: Bearer <your-webhook-token>

Finally, click “Add Webhook” to finish the setup. Once complete, your AI Teammates will be ready to start running autonomous alert response workflows. For additional configuration options and custom header setup, check out our PagerDuty integration documentation.

Automate Incident Response with AI Teammates 

With the PagerDuty Connector now active, every new incident that triggers a PagerDuty alert will automatically notify your AI Teammates to begin an investigation. To demonstrate, let’s walk through a real-world example, where a P1 alert fires for a fraud-scorer service experiencing sustained p99 latency above 2 seconds:

Once the ticket is created, the OnCall AI super-agent instantly starts a new thread, tags the SRE Teammate, and initiates triage. After reviewing the impacted services, OnCall AI upgrades the severity to a P0 to more accurately reflect incident impact, while the SRE Teammate begins querying  relevant telemetry data, building a timeline of events, and correlating failures across the environment:

During the investigation, the SRE Teammate identifies the root cause: node-level memory pressure causing the fraud-scorer service to degrade. The nodes hit 95% memory utilization due to other services repeatedly crashing and restarting from memory leaks. This memory pressure caused the fraud-scorer’s ML model performance to collapse, spiking latency from 40ms to 2.8+ seconds:

From here, the SRE Teammate provides actionable remediation steps: immediately increase memory allocation for the fraud-scorer service to restore functionality, then investigate the crash loops in payment-processor and session-cache to fix the underlying memory leaks that are causing the node-level pressure.

Faced with a P0 incident impacting multiple services, AI Teammates autonomously correlated logs, checked Kubernetes events, queried node metrics, and built a historical timeline — completing in minutes what would’ve been an extensive manual investigation. The SRE Teammate fully investigated the incident with clear root cause analysis and actionable next steps, allowing the on-call engineer to jump straight into remediation instead of starting from scratch.
